Abstract


The study was carried out to identify the constraints perceived by dairy farmers in Banda District. The sample size of 160 dairy farmers was randomly selected for the study and data were collected through personal interview method during 2019-20. Multi stage random sampling technique was adopted for the study with the Ex-Post Facto research design. Banda consists of eight blocks, out of which two blocks were selected randomly viz. Badokhar Khurd and Tindwari. From the selected blocks, four villages were selected randomly from each and 20 Dairy farmers selected from each selected village. Study reveals that about 90 percent respondents believed, location of veterinary health centers as the major constraints which is followed by lack of knowledge about balanced feeding is another major (81.45%). Other major constraints were high cost disease treatment and lack of knowledge about scientific dairy management in the study area
